<p>To establish a business, selecting a registered agent is a crucial decision, and there are specific requirements that must be adhered to. Generally, a registered agent must be a resident of the state in which the business operates or a corporation authorized to do business in that state. This agent is responsible for receiving legal documents and government correspondence on behalf of the business. Each state has its own statutes governing registered agent requirements, so it is essential to understand the particular regulations that apply in your location.</p>

<p>The costs associated with registered agent services can vary widely depending on the provider and the services offered. The basic fees for hiring a registered agent typically range from $50 to $300 dollars annually. Many <a href="https://xn----7sbarohhk4a0dxb3c.xn--p1ai/user/dimpleshoe75/">commercial registered agent</a> s offer additional services, such as compliance reminders, annual report filing, and business mail handling, which can affect the overall cost. When considering affordability, it is important to compare different registered agent providers to find the best solution that fits your business needs and budget.</p>

<p>Beyond initial costs, businesses should be mindful of potential fees for changes, updates, or renewals related to registered agent services. For instance, if you decide to change your registered agent, there may be additional charges associated with the filing of the registered agent change form. Moreover, companies opting for online registered agent services often find that these can offer cost-effective solutions without compromising on reliability or professionalism, making them a popular choice among new businesses.</p>

<p>What might be typical requirements for a registered agent? Registered agents must be residents of the state where the business is registered or a business entity authorized to conduct business in that state. They should be available during business hours to receive documents. According to the state, there may be certain registered agent requirements, such as maintaining a physical address rather than a P.O. box.</p>
